Heritage and Prophecy: Grundtvig and the English Speaking World

Rate this book
THe publication of this book results from an interdisciplinary dialogue between scholars from Denmark, England and the United States of America, organized by the Cetre for Grundtvig Studies in Aarhus.

336 pages, Hardcover

First published June 1, 1994

Gives you a good introduction to Grundtvig's view of Christianity and history, as well as giving you an impression of his influence on Danish society.

As always with these sort of collections the essays are of varying quality, and for me a few of them where quite laborious to get through (I am not big on hymnody). However I thought the majority of essays dealing with history and theology were well written.
